The Welsh Government has announced a new HPV vaccination programme for men who have sex with men (MSM), to rolled-out across Wales from 1st April.
The vaccine is being offered to all MSM up to 45 years of age who attend sexual health clinics, following a recommendation by the Joint Committee on Vaccination and Immunisation (JCVI).
Commenting, Welsh Lib Dem Equalities Spokesperson, Cadan ap Tomos, said;
"The Welsh Liberal Democrats welcome this announcement as a step towards protecting men who have sex with men against certain cancers. The HPV vaccine is proven to be effective in reducing these risks and should be welcomed.
"However, while this is a step in the right direction, we want to see the programme go further. All boys aged 14 in Wales should be vaccinated on the same basis as their female peers to ensure the maximum protection, and make sure that gay and bisexual men aren't at a discriminatory risk of developing these cancers later on in life."
